3 years ago today about 5 weeks after sidux said to to world that 'we are on deck', the sidux Operating System Manual was uploaded and sent live online.

Back then it consisted of about 25 files and in 2 languages (DE and EN). Very rapidly the language translations mounted, first with Spanish, then in rapid succession other languages followed and today it stands at 16 languages.

Today the sidux Operating System Manual contains 48 text files, plus screenies, with 2 of the files I term as nemesis files (monsters) and as of today another file is waiting in the wings regarding the ability to network boot sidux, (which will be added after the 2009-04 release).

About 2 years ago the sidux Community Software Selections Manual was added, (it used to be known as the meta-manual from an idea of zulu9 who had a huge influence on its development). It now consists of some 172 text files plus a huge screenie database and is available in 8 languages and weighs in at 43MB. (To give you an idea of what that means compared with the sidux Operating System Manual, the Operating System Manual weighs in at 27MB).

To state the effort of some 40 translators over time in monetary terms, there are in excess of 820,000 lines of code across all languages and it is valued at USD$12,600,000 (this is not a typo!).
